ACV Auctions’ (ACVA) stock has significantly underperformed its peers over the past year [cite: data provided], but how does it truly stack against competitors in the rapidly evolving digital automotive marketplace driven by AI innovation? A closer look reveals robust revenue growth [cite: data provided] but persistent operating losses [cite: data provided, 4, 10] and a negative P/E [cite: data provided, 10]. However, a strong free cash flow margin [cite: data provided] suggests operational efficiency, offering a nuanced view amidst tempered market outlooks and the company’s clear path to profitability.

  • ACVA’s -9.7% operating margin, lowest among peers (AN 4.6%), reflects investment in its digital platform and expansion, hindering current profitability.
  • ACVA’s 23.4% revenue growth, outpacing peers, shows successful digital platform adoption and market share gains in a transforming auto auction industry.
  • ACVA’s 68.7% stock drop (PE -15.0), underperforming peers, signals investor concern over missed earnings and long-term profitability amidst growth.

Here’s how ACV Auctions stacks up across size, valuation, and profitability versus key peers.

  ACVA AN MUSA GPI
Market Cap ($ Bil) 1.1 7.4 7.1 5.0
Revenue ($ Bil) 0.7 27.9 19.5 22.5
PE Ratio -15.0 11.2 14.5 13.3
LTM Revenue Growth 23.4% 6.1% -8.0% 19.4%
LTM Operating Margin -9.7% 4.6% 3.8% 4.4%
LTM FCF Margin 6.2% -0.6% 1.9% 2.2%
12M Market Return -68.7% 17.8% -30.7% -5.7%
